Retail cuts of lamb

WebThere are five basic major (primal) cuts of lamb: leg, loin, shoulder, rack and shank/breast.*. Lamb is divided into large sections called primal cuts, which you can see in the chart above. These large cuts are then broken down further into individual retail cuts that you buy at the supermarket or butcher's shop. …
